Claude: --- Text Processing Script:

interface TextProcessor {
  process(text: string): string;
}

class NoteFoldProcessor implements TextProcessor {
  process(text: string): string {
    // Split the text into lines while preserving empty lines
    const lines = text.split(/\r?\n/);
    
    // Add the note header as the first line
    const processedLines = ['> [!NOTE]'];
    
    // Process each line
    lines.forEach((line, index) => {
      // Skip empty lines at the start
      if (index === 0 && line.trim() === '') {
        return;
      }
      
      // For empty lines, just add a '>' to preserve spacing
      if (line.trim() === '') {
        processedLines.push('>');
      } else {
        // Add '> ' prefix to non-empty lines
        processedLines.push(`> ${line}`);
      }
    });
    
    // Join the lines back together with newlines
    return processedLines.join('\n');
  }
}

// Example usage:
const processor = new NoteFoldProcessor();
const inputText = `mimansajaiswal: write notation-fold.ts similar to notion-highlight.ts where if a region is marked to be collapsed, it allows you to collapse it and expand it similar to code folding in ides.

this is how it works with multiple lines in code highlight:

Use [!code highlight] to highlight a line.

\`\`\`ts
console.log('Not highlighted')
console.log('Highlighted') // [!code highlight]
console.log('Not highlighted')
\`\`\``;

console.log(processor.process(inputText));

I've created a TypeScript script that processes text according to your requirements. Here's what it does:

  1. Takes any input text
  2. Adds '> [!NOTE]' at the top
  3. Adds '> ' to every line
  4. Preserves all newlines and spacing
  5. Handles empty lines by adding just '>' to maintain spacing

To use it, you can:

  1. Create a new instance of the processor
  2. Pass your text to the process() method
  3. Get back the formatted text

The code uses TypeScript interfaces and classes for better maintainability and type safety. Would you like me to modify anything about how it processes the text?
